Inverness city centre is compact, and most of these hotels sit within a short walk of the main sights. The Royal Highland Hotel is right on the doorstep of the railway station, while the River Ness Hotel puts the station, shops, and restaurants at your feet. For a central location with parking, the B&B Hotel Inverness combines stylish rooms with easy private parking, and the Premier Inn Millburn Rd offers free parking and an indoor pool, still walkable to the station and centre.
The Premier Inn Inverness Millburn Rd starts from £24 per night, making it the most budget-friendly option among central hotels. It offers free parking and an indoor pool, though it's a short walk from the rail station and city centre.
Ness Walk holds the top guest rating among central hotels, with a 9.1 score from over 1,100 reviews. This 5-star riverside retreat offers elegant rooms and a garden patio, with rates from £135.
Yes, the city centre is compact and walkable, with many hotels like the River Ness Hotel or the Glen Mhor Hotel placing you within a short stroll of restaurants, pubs, and the riverfront. The area is generally lively, especially around the city centre and the river.
Inverness is a popular gateway to the Highlands, so booking at least 2-3 months ahead is wise, especially for summer visits or during the Northern Lights season. For the best rates, consider travelling in the shoulder months (April-May or September-October) when prices are often lower than peak summer.
The Inverness Palace Hotel & Spa is just minutes from the castle, with a riverside location and a spa. The AC Hotel by Marriott is a 5-minute walk from the castle, offering modern rooms with river views.
Inverness is a compact city, and its central hotels cluster along the River Ness and the streets around the railway station. From the 5-star Ness Walk with its garden patio to the budget Premier Inn Millburn Rd just a walk from the rail station, the range is unusually wide for a city this size. The river is the constant: most of the top-rated properties sit on or near its banks, with many offering views of the castle or the water.
What the money buys varies more than the location. At the budget end, from around £24, you get practical stays like the Premier Inn Millburn Rd or the Inverness Youth Hostel, both with free parking. At the top, Rocpool Reserve and Ness Walk command rates above £300 for boutique luxury or riverside elegance. Around 12 of these hotels are 3-star, 9 are 4-star, and 2 are 5-star, so mid-range comfort is the sweet spot, with typical rates near £72.
